1993 Chevrolet Astro vs. 2004 Hyundai Trajet
To start off, 2004 Hyundai Trajet is newer by 11 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1993 Chevrolet Astro.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1993 Chevrolet Astro would be higher. At 4,293 cc (6 cylinders), 1993 Chevrolet Astro is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1993 Chevrolet Astro (183 HP @ 4400 RPM) has 12 more horse power than 2004 Hyundai Trajet. (171 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1993 Chevrolet Astro should accelerate faster than 2004 Hyundai Trajet.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1993 Chevrolet Astro weights approximately 43 kg more than 2004 Hyundai Trajet.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1993 Chevrolet Astro is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2004 Hyundai Trajet.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1993 Chevrolet Astro will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1993 Chevrolet Astro (338 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 154 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Hyundai Trajet. (184 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1993 Chevrolet Astro will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Hyundai Trajet. 2004 Hyundai Trajet has automatic transmission and 1993 Chevrolet Astro has manual transmission. 1993 Chevrolet Astro will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2004 Hyundai Trajet will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
1993 Chevrolet Astro | 2004 Hyundai Trajet | |
Make | Chevrolet | Hyundai |
Model | Astro | Trajet |
Year Released | 1993 | 2004 |
Body Type | Minivan | Minivan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4293 cc | 2655 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 183 HP | 171 HP |
Engine RPM | 4400 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 338 Nm | 184 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2800 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 101.7 mm | 86.7 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 88.4 mm | 75 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 8 seats | 7 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1895 kg | 1852 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4830 mm | 4700 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1980 mm | 1850 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1910 mm | 1720 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2830 mm | 2840 mm |
